San FranciscoMay 29, 2002Macromedia,
Inc. (Nasdaq: MACR) today announced the availability
of its Macromedia MX product line. Macromedia
Studio MX, Macromedia
Dreamweaver MX, Macromedia
ColdFusion MX, and Macromedia
Fireworks MX are all available for immediate purchase
today from the Macromedia Online Store (www.macromedia.com/store/).
Combined with Macromedia
Flash MX, which began shipping in March, these
products form an integrated product family for creating
rich Internet applications that promise significantly
more intuitive, responsive, and effective user experiences.
Macromedia enables designers and developers to deliver
solutions across the widest range of operating systems,
browsers, and mobile devices in the industry.
Individually, the products in the Macromedia MX family
are major new releases that offer designers and developers
powerful new functionality for creating effective
user experiences across the spectrum of Internet solutions,
from basic websites to complex web applications. The
Macromedia MX family is designed to leverage leading
Internet standards including the Microsoft .NET Framework
and Java application servers, XML, accessibility,
and Macromedia Flash Player, the most widely distributed
rich client on the Internet, which is deployed to
98 percent of web users. Rich Internet applications
take advantage of rich client technology, which extends
the capabilities of web browsers and Internet-connected
devices.
Leading customers including SAP, Siemens, Citrix,
Earthlink, GE Access, and CableCom rely on an Enterprise
Presales Management (EPM) software solution created
with the entire MX product family by Blue Roads, a
Macromedia Alliance partner. The ColdFusion application
is being upgraded to ColdFusion MX, and a new interface
is being developed using Macromedia Dreamweaver MX
and Macromedia Flash MX. The new application will
result in a streamlined user experience that reduces
the number of screens by 75 percent. This application
will give salespeople all the information they need
in one place, searchable and sortable across many
different fields, which will improve the user experience
and reduce task completion time by more than 50 percent.
"The Macromedia MX product line has enabled
us to create software that allows large companies
selling through multiple sales channels to manage
their presales process, significantly increase their
lead closing rate, and increase their marketing ROI,"
said Axel Schultze, CEO, Blue Roads. "Macromedia
enables us to deliver a presales solution whereby
salespeople have all relevant lead information in
front of them with an intuitive interface that helps
them be more productive."
